.collection-images{display:flex;gap:24px 8px;}
.ci-inr a{display:block;}
.collection-images img,.collection-images video{aspect-ratio:2/3;width:100%;}
.ci-media{line-height:0;}
.ci-meta{padding-top:12px;}
.ci-meta h3{font-size:12px;line-height:16px;text-transform:uppercase;font-weight:400;}
@media(min-width:992px){
  .ci-inr{flex:1;}
}
@media(max-width:991px){
  .collection-images{flex-wrap:wrap;}
  .ci-inr{flex:0 0 calc(50% - 4px);max-width:calc(50% - 4px);}
}